Monitor supply chain intelligence to detect risks
- Isn't it great when you buy something online, and you can track your package? We've all become accustomed to being able to see where our deliveries are in real-time as they make their way from one shipping center to the next. When managing supply chain risk, it's helpful to have real-time monitoring of items moving globally. It's also important that we monitor our risks. Those things that can create disruptions to us. The key objective is to detect problems early so they can be managed before they create a big disruption. For example, a smoke detector detects fire early allowing people to evacuate before they're trapped. And as the fire is ideally still small it might be extinguished easily. So what we need to do is to detect issues early so we can quickly respond to ensure our supply chain does not have a heavy disruption.
